> Has somebody used SmartCards with OpenCA to distribute user certificates?
several people did - but its mainly not an OpenCA issue...

There are two possible scenarios:
1) Users create the certificates on the smart-card their own - all you need i to integrate the cards in the user's browser - everything else is as with "soft-keys" and handled by the browser

2) a central department creates the cards - in this case you either do the same like in a) or you use the batch module. The batch itself is currently unable to create certificates on the card but can provide you a bunch of keys that you can install on the cards (mind that keys are created outside the card!). They other alternative is to write a script yourself that create csr's using the cards and producing data that can be read by the batch....but you will need to touch the card two times in this situation
